Accountabilities:
Key Deliverables:
Pre-Contract:
- Lead/Support tender and estimating processes commercially.
- Lead/Support reviews of contract conditions and involvement in contract negotiations and amendments.
- Lead/Support contractual negotiations, agreement of wording and limits of security in respect of Performance Bonds, Parent Company Guarantees, Warranties and Insurances.
- Lead/Support the commercial strategy setting for projects.
- Lead the setting up of contractual forms/templates.
- Ensure that suppler and sub-contract orders are placed in accordance with Dalkia procedures ensuring the correct transfer of risks and step-down provisions accordingly.
- Lead/support the negotiation of suppler and sub-contractor terms and conditions including levels or limits of liability, insurances etc.
- Lead/support the drafting and issuing of contractual correspondence.
- Lead the administration, management, and control of sub-contract accounts and variations incl. performance/compliance reviews.
- Timely review, valuation, assessment, and certification of payments
- Develop and maintain professional relationships with the Supply Chain, to help future business development.
- Lead/support the validation and agreement of final accounts.
- Lead/support the resolution of disputes, including preparation of associated documentation/records.
Reporting & Forecasting:
- Preparation and presenting of monthly budgets, forecasts, accounts and reports accurate project.
- Attend/support internal and external progress, operational and commercial meetings.
- Lead/support the Commercial and Supply Chain Director during commercial and contractual audits of worksites and suppliers as required to maintain compliance and implementation of key learning.
Contract Administration & Risk Management:
- Implement project commercial and contractual strategies.
- Protect the business position and commercial/contractual obligations at all times whilst working collaboratively with our clients and supply chain.
- Ensure compliance with Dalkia commercial and/or contract policies and/or procedures.
- Key advisor to the Directors on project commercial and/or contractual matters.
- Key advisor to the Project Management team on the day-to-day commercial risks and associated issues that arise during the lifecycle of the project.
- Develop and maintain professional relationships with the Client, to help future business development.
- Implement risk management strategy, monitoring and reporting procedure
- Negotiation and agreement of final accounts.
- Lead/support the resolution of disputes, including preparation of associated documentation/records.
Contract Cost Control & Valuations:
- Produce cost reports and forecasts.
- Prepare accurate and timely Client valuations/applications for payment.
- Attend site walks to review and agree certifications.
- Ensure payments are received on time
- Implement escalation procedures surrounding non-certifications and/or overdue/late payments
- Maintain strong cashflow into the business through the appropriate tracking and monitoring of performance.
Change Management:
- Implement change management strategy/plan
- Lead the identification of variations in scope and ensure entitlement is secured through the contractual notifications process.
- Maximise entitlement with respect to profitability and/or revenue and mitigate and minimise exposure and costs
- Ensure processes and procedures are implemented on projects to retain contemporaneous records.
- Assess the implications in terms of cost and/or time, prepare and submit assessments for recovery.
- Negotiate and agree variations in scope.
- Ensure costs and recovery of variations in scope are tracked and reported as part of change management procedure.
Supply Chain Management:
- Implement supply chain management strategy/plan
- Ensure all suppliers and sub-contractors are pre-qualified and procured in accordance with company procedures.
- Lead the preparation and issuing of enquiry packs and vetting of quotations received.
